Full Stack Engineer

Engineering

Full-time Porto, Portugal

Description

Why Losch Digital Lab?
Inspired by the exciting new challenges associated with the ongoing mobility revolution, Losch Luxembourg is investing on the development of new products, aiming to improve the experience and efficiency in this area, both for business and for the final consumers. If you are willing to contribute and create value for tomorrow’s cleaner and smarter mobility, Losch Digital Lab is the place to be.

Losch Digital Lab is a dynamic and innovative company within the Losch Group, specialized in delivering cutting-edge software solutions for the automotive and mobility industries. Since we started in 2018, we delivered a broad range of software solutions to our clients, ranging from an all-in-one mobility on demand solution and a suite of products for used car management and after-sales services, to e-commerce solutions and tailored software development.

For our software factory, we are currently looking for a Full Stack Engineer to join our team and contribute to the success of our products.

Skills

Your responsibilities:
- Design, develop, and test features from backend to frontend on our Simdle Mobility Platform;
- Implement business logic in a Java application;
- Maintain Postgres database;
- Update React web application and Rest APIs for the frontend application;
- Translate requirements into tangible features of our SaaS platform;
- Work together with the development team and evangelize good practices;
- Provide robust and quality code with unit/integration testing.

Your Qualifications:
- 2+ years of experience as a software developer;
- Worked for a SaaS company or technology start-up;
- Experience with Android/Mobile development (nice to have);
- Solid understanding of software development principles;
- Knowledge of play framework (or spring boot or ktor);
- Experience of rest APIs, Java, SQL (+postgres or mysql or oracle), and Web frameworks;
- Experience with React (or other frontend framework), JUnit, gradle (or maven);
- Proactive and enjoy suggesting improvements;
- Experience with GitLab, Confluence and Jira;
- Natural focus on clean code and automated testing;
- Team player with good interpersonal and communication skills;
- Fluency in English; knowledge in any other european language is a plus.

We offer:
- Competitive salary based on your skills and experience;
- Sponsorship for your training and development;
- Office/remote options;
- Special employees' purchasing conditions;
- Authenticity and people-first culture! We believe in self-improvement as the spark for team, products, and company improvements.

down arrow